2.0 QUALITATIVE AND QUANTITATIVE COMPOSITION :
Each film coated tablet contains:
Chlordiazepoxide I.P. 5 mg
Clidinium Bromide USP 2.5 mg
Excipients q.s.
Colours: Titanium Dioxide I.P., Ferric Oxide USP NF Yellow & Indigo Carmine Aluminum Lake

4.0 CLINICAL PARTICULARS
4.1 THERAPEUTIC INDICATIO

Indicated for the treatment of organic manifestations of anxiety and tension in gastrointestinal and genitourinary tracts. The conditions may (but not limited to) include irritable bowel syndrome, dysmenorrhea, gastric & duodenal ulcer, gastro-duodenitis, intestinal spasms, ureteric spasm, biliary dyskinesia etc.

4.2 POSOLOGY AND METHOD OF ADMINISTRATION
Adults:
1–2 tablets 3–4 times daily. Elderly or debilitated: 1-2 tabs daily initially, then may increase gradually. In dysmenorrhoea, the drug should be taken three to four days prior to menstruation or as directed by the physician
Children: Not recommended
Elderly or debilitated patients and Special patient groups: In elderly patients, renal or hepatic insufficiency, dosage adjustment is required.
The tablets should be swallowed with water. They may be taken with meals, when going to bed or when experiencing pain. Treatment must be as brief as possible. The indication will be re-evaluated regularly, especially in the absence of symptoms. The total duration of treatment should not exceed 8 to 12 weeks for the majority of patients.

4.3 CONTRAINDICATIONS
Librax is contraindicated in

  • hypersensitivity to the active substances or to any of the excipients
  • Pathological subjects aged over 65 years, patients aged over 75 years and children under 6 years
  • Risk of angle-closure glaucoma
  • Risk of urinary retention associated with urethra-prostatic disorders
  • Breastfeeding
  • Severe respiratory insufficiency
  • Sleep apnoea syndrome
  • Severe, acute or chronic hepatic insufficiency (risk of occurrence of encephalopathy)
  • Myasthenia gravis

4.4 SPECIAL WARNINGS AND PRECAUTIONS FOR USE
Synergistic Effect
Benzodiazepines such as chlordiazepoxide can have a synergistic effect with other drugs especially sedatives and Clidinium may have synergistic effects with atropine or other anti-muscarinic drugs.
Duration of treatment
The duration of treatment including the tapering off process, should be as short as possible but should not exceed 8 to 12 weeks. Only after re-evaluation of the situation, extension beyond these periods may be done.
When benzodiazepines with a long duration of action are being used, change to a benzodiazepine with a short duration of action should not be done, as withdrawal symptoms may develop.
Alcohol and drug abuse
Caution is to be exercised before commencing therapy, if there is a history of alcoholism or other dependences, drug related or otherwise.
Major depressive episodes
Since they allow depression to develop separately with a persistent or increased risk of suicide, benzodiazepines should not be prescribed alone
Tolerance
After repeated use, loss of efficacy to the hypnotic effects of benzodiazepines may develop.
Dependence
Use of benzodiazepines (even at therapeutic doses) may lead to the development of physical and psychic dependence upon these products which is dose and time dependent. The risk of dependence increases with a history of alcohol or drug abuse. If the treatment is withdrawn abruptly, symptoms like insomnia, muscle tension, muscle pain, headaches, tension, restlessness, confusion, hyperreactivity, extreme anxiety, and irritability may develop. In severe cases the following symptoms may occur: derealisation, hypersensitivity to light, depersonalisation, hyperacusis, noise and physical contact, hallucinations, numbness and tingling of the extremities, or epileptic seizures.
Rebound reactions
Upon the withdrawal of therapy, a transient syndrome may occur whereby the symptoms that led to treatment with a benzodiazepine recur in an enhanced form which are accompanied by other reactions such as mood changes, anxiety or sleep disturbances and restlessness. The dosage is reduced gradually as risk of withdrawal/rebound phenomena is greater after abrupt discontinuation of treatment.
Amnesia and alteration in psychomotor function
Benzodiazepines may induce anterograde amnesia along with alterations in the psychomotor functions several hours after ingesting the drug.
Psychiatric and paradoxical reactions
Benzodiazepines may give rise to an alteration in the state of consciousness, behavioural and memory problems, the symptoms of which are aggravation of insomnia, nightmares, agitation, nervousness, loss of inhibitions with impulsiveness, psychotic type symptoms, anterograde amnesia, delirious thoughts, hallucinations, euphoria, irritability, confusional state, suggestibility. Discontinue treatment, if these symptoms occur. Extreme caution should be used prescribing benzodiazepines to patients with personality disorders.
Paradoxical reactions to chlordiazepoxide hydrochloride such as excitement, stimulation and acute rage, have been observed in psychiatric patients and the patient must be monitored for during Librax (chlordiazepoxide and clidinium) therapy.
Withdrawal symptoms
Withdrawal symptoms of the barbiturate type have occurred after the discontinuation of benzodiazepines.

Debilitated patients
In debilitated patients, the dose of Librax must be limited to the smallest effective amount to prevent the development of ataxia, over-sedation or confusion. It has been recommended that initially not more than 2 Librax (chlordiazepoxide and clidinium) tablets per day be given, and then the dose may be increased gradually as required depending on the tolerability of the patient. The concomitant administration of Librax and other psychotropic agents is not recommended. If such combination therapy is given, careful consideration must be given to the pharmacology of the drugs to be administered, particularly drugs such as the MAO inhibitors and phenothiazines.
Prostate hypertrophy
Caution should be exercised in prescribing Clidinium bromide to prostate hypertrophy patients.

Renal or hepatic Impairment
Caution should be exercised in prescribing Clidinium bromide to patients with renal and hepatic impairment.
Coronary insufficiency, heart rate problems, hyperthyroidism
Caution should be exercised in prescribing Clidinium bromide to these patients.
Carcinogenesis, Mutagenesis and effect of fertility
In in-vivo and in-vitro studies with chlordiazepoxide indicate a mutagenic effect. In carcinogenicity studies in mice an increase of liver tumor was seen at high doses, especially in males, whereas no increase of tumor incidence was seen in rats.
No clear evidence of a teratogenic effect of chlordiazepoxide have been seen in studies in humans.
Pediatric population.
The product is not recommended in children
Elderly
Elderly patients may be more prone to experience drowsiness, ataxia and confusion if receiving Librax (chlordiazepoxide and clidinium) . These effects can usually be avoided with the correct dosage adjustment. But a point to note is that, these adverse reactions have occasionally been observed even at the lower dosage ranges. Hence dosing in geriatric subjects must be initiated cautiously (no more than 2 tablets per day) and can be increased gradually if needed and tolerated.

4.5 DRUG INTERACTIONS

No Drug Drug Interactions Remarks
1. Centrally-acting drugs such as neuroleptics, tranquilisers, antidepressants, hypnotics, analgesics, anaesthetics, antitussives, sedative anti-histamines, central antihypertensives, and baclofen If Chlordiazepoxide is combined with centrally-acting drugs, the central depressive effects are likely to be intensified.In the case of narcotic analgesics with Chlordiazepoxide, enhancement of the euphoria may also occur leading to an increase in psychic dependence.
2. Barbiturates Concomitant use of barbiturates and chlordiazepoxide leads to increased risk of respiratory depression, which may be fatal in the event of overdose.
3. Buprenorphine Concomitant use of buprenorphine with Chlordiazepoxide leads to increased risk of respiratory depression which may be fatal. Risk-benefit ratio of this combination should be evaluated carefully.
4. Cimetidine Increased risk of drowsiness when chlordiazepoxide and cimetidine are co-administered. Patients should be warned about the increased risk of drowsiness and the attendant difficulty in driving and using machinery and the subsequent risks involved
5. Products derived from morphine Increased risk of respiratory depression, when co-administered with chlordiazepoxide, which may be fatal in the event of overdose.
6. Product which inhibit hepatic enzymes Compounds which inhibit certain hepatic enzymes (particularly cytochrome P450) may enhance the activity of benzodiazepines.
7. Atropine-like substances, substances having anticholinergic action belonging to the following therapeutic groups: antidepressants, antihistamine (H1 antagonists), antiparkinsonian agents, anticholinergics, other atropinic antispasmodics, disopyramide, phenothiazine neuroleptics, clozapine and amantadine Atropine-like substances can increase the side effects and aggravate urinary retention, glaucoma, constipation, dry mouth, etc. when given concomitantly along with Clidinium bromide

4.6 USE IN SPECIAL POPULATION
Pregnancy
Librax is contraindicated in pregnancy. An increased risk of congenital malformations has been reported with the use of minor tranquilizers such as chlordiazepoxide during the first trimester of pregnancy. Patients should be advised that if they become pregnant during therapy or intend to become pregnant they should communicate with their physicians about the desirability of discontinuing the drug. The possibility that a woman of childbearing potential might be pregnant at the time of initiation of therapy must be considered.
Breast-feeding
Both Clidinium and chlordiazepoxide can appear in the breast milk Clidinium may decrease milk secretion and it may also pass into milk. This can result in atropinic
effects in the child. Therefore, the use of Librax is not recommended during breast feeding.

4.7 EFFECTS ON ABILITY TO DRIVE AND USE MACHINES
As there is risk of drowsiness, medication should not be used when driving or operating heavy machinery.

4.8 UNDESIRABLE EFFECTS
Most common adverse effects include sedation, ataxia, fatigue, somnolence, dizziness, and balance disorder. The elderly are particularly sensitive to the effects of centrally-depressant drugs and may experience confusion.

Organ Class Effect
General disorders and administration site conditions Dry mouth, fatigue
Blood and lymphatic system Bone marrow depression (e.g. pancytopenia leucopenia, thrombocytopenia, agranulocytosis, acute thrombocytopenic purpura)
Psychiatric disorders Depression, restlessness, agitation, irritability, paradoxical drug reaction (e.g. anxiety, sleep disorders, insomnia, suicide attempt, suicidal ideation), amnesia, emotional disturbances, depressed level of consciousness, aggression, delusion, dependence, hallucinations, nightmares, psychotic disorder, abnormal behaviour,
Nervous system disorders Confusional state, vertigo, dizziness, dysarthria, sedation, headache, extrapyramidal disorder (e.g tremor, dyskinesia), somnolence, gait disturbance, ataxia, balance disorder,
Immune system disorders Hypersensitivity
Cardiac disorders Palpitations, tachycardia
Vascular disorders Hypotension
Respiratory, thoracic and mediastinal disorders Increased viscosity of bronchial secretion, respiratory depression
Gastrointestinal disorders Constipation
Metabolism and nutrition disorders Increased appetite
Hepato-biliary disorders Raised bilirubin, alkaline phosphatise and transaminases, jaundice
Skin and subcutaneous tissues disorders Skin reaction
Eye disorders Diplopia, decreased lacrimation, visual impairment accommodation disorders
Musculoskeletal, connective tissue disorders Asthenia, muscular weakness
Renal and urinary disorders urinary retention
Reproductive system and breast disorders Menstrual disorder, erectile dysfunction, dysmenorrhoea, libido disorder

4.9 OVERDOSE
Associated with chlordiazepoxide

Symptoms: Benzodiazepine overdosage can result in life threatening complications especially if the patient has taken other central nervous system depressants (including alcohol). The symptoms of overdose include drowsiness, mental confusion, drowsiness and lethargy. The more serious cases, symptoms may include hypotonia, ataxia, respiratory depression, rarely coma and very rarely death.
Treatment: In the conscious patient vomiting should be induced within one hour or gastric lavage can be undertaken with the airway protected if the patient is unconscious. Activated charcoal can be administered to reduce absorption. Monitor respiratory and cardiovascular functions. Flumazenil is a Benzodiazepine antagonist which may be useful in the diagnosis and/or treatment of overdose with benzodiazepines.
Associated with clidinium bromide
Symptoms: Patients with overdose of Clidinium bromide may present with anticholinergic effects such as dry mouth, urinary retention, tachycardia, redness of the skin, reduced gastrointestinal motility, mild drowsiness and transient disturbances of vision (including mydriasis, accommodation paralysis). The more serious disturbances include circulatory and respiratory alterations, tachycardia, delirium. Arousal state, agitation, confusion and hallucination, respiratory depression and coma.
Treatment: Symptomatic with cardiac and respiratory monitoring in a hospital environment.

5.0 PHARMACOLOGICAL PROPERTIES
5.1 Mechanism of action

Chlordiazepoxide is an anxiolytic belonging to the class of benzodiazepines.
Pharmacologically its properties are those of the class of benzodiazepines: anxiolytic,
sedative, hypnotic, anticonvulsant, myorelaxant and amnestic. These effects are associate with a specific agonist action on a central receptor forming part of the GABA-OMEGA macromolecular receptors complex (also known as BZ1 and BZ2) modulating the opening of the chlorine channel. Drug dependence may be observed in animals and in humans. Clidinium bromide is a synthetic anticholinergic that has a spasmolytic effect on smooth muscle and also inhibits secretions.

5.3 Pharmacokinetic Properties

Parameters Chlordiazepoxide Clidinium bromide
Absorption Well absorbed, with peak blood levels being achieved one or two hours after administration.
Steady-state levels are usually reached within three days.
Incompletely absorbed from the GI tract since it is completely ionized
Bioavailability Bioavailability after oral dose is close to 100%.
Distribution The Foeto-placental crossover and passing into the mother’s milk have been demonstrated for benzodiazepines. Steady-state levels of active metabolites are reached after 10-15 days, with metabolite concentrations which are similar to those of the parent drug. Does not readily penetrate the CNS or the eye. There is no data regarding the passage of clidinium bromide into the placenta or into milk
Metabolism Metabolised into desmethyl-chlordiazepoxide. Also metabolised to a much lesser extent to the active metabolite demoxapam.The demoxepam is itself metabolised into an active metabolite, oxazepam, but in very small proportions Metabolised into 3-hydroxy-1-methylquinuclidinium bromide, which is the principal form found in the urine of humans.
Excretion Urinary elimination takes the form of demoxepam and oxazepam. Clidinium bromide and its metabolites are found in faeces.
Half-life Chlordiazepoxide half-life is 6-30 hours.
Demoxepam and oxazepam half-life is 20 to 24 hours.
Biphasic; initial half-life was 2.4 hours and terminal half-life is about 20 hours

6.0 NON-CLINICAL PROPERTIES
6.1 ANIMAL TOXICOLOGY OR PHARMACOLOGY

Mutagenic and tumorigenic potential:
In in-vivo and in-vitro studies with chlordiazepoxide there are indications for a mutagenic effect. Nevertheless, in similar test systems results are negative. The relevance of the positive findings is currently unclear. In carcinogenicity studies in mice an increase of liver tumors was seen at high doses, especially in males, whereas no increase of tumor incidence was seen in rats.

Reproductive toxicity:
Observations in humans have shown no clear evidence of a teratogenic effect of chlordiazepoxide up to now, whereas in animal studies changes in the urogenital tract, lung anomalies and malformations of the skull (exencephaly, cleft palate), behavioral disorders and neurochemical changes have been observed in the offspring. The malformation risk with administration of therapeutic doses of benzodiazepines in early pregnancy appears to be low, although some epidemiological studies have found evidence of an increased risk for the occurrence of cleft palate and there are few case reports of malformations and mental retardation of prenatally exposed children after chlordiazepoxide overdose and poisoning.
